Radiation Stewardship (ALARA)
Evidence suggests that for routine Crohn's follow-up, skipping the plain and arterial phases significantly reduces radiation without compromising diagnosis of abscesses or strictures.
Protocol Consistency
Essential for longitudinal assessment. Changes in wall thickness or comb sign must be compared to baseline using identical phases.
Neutral Contrast Rule
Neutral contrast (Mannitol/Water) is strictly preferred to assess mural enhancement; positive contrast masks hypervascularity.

Reporting Expectations Checklist
Small Bowel Segments
Bowel Distension
Assess loop distribution and adequacy of luminal diameter.
Wall Characteristics
Thickness, enhancement pattern, and mural stratification.
Strictures
Identify transition points and pre-stenotic dilatation.
Complications
Fistulae & Abscesses
Check for entero-enteric fistulae or fluid collections.
Inflammatory Masses
Assess for phlegmon or mesenteric conglomerate loops.
Extra-luminal / Solid Organs
Mesenteric Findings
Fat stranding, Comb sign (engorged vasa recta), Lymphadenopathy.
Solid Abdominal Organs
Explicit assessment of Liver, Spleen, Kidneys, and Peritoneum.
